◉ A 47-year-old female patient is transferred from the recovery
room to a surgical unit after a transverse colostomy. The nurse
observes the stoma to be deep pink with edema and a small amount
of sanguineous drainage. The nurse should
a. place ice packs around the stoma.
b. notify the surgeon about the stoma.
c. monitor the stoma every 30 minutes.
d. document stoma assessment findings. Answer: D
◉ Which information will the nurse include in teaching a patient
who had a proctocolectomy and ileostomy for ulcerative colitis?
a. Restrict fluid intake to prevent constant liquid drainage from the
stoma.
b. Use care when eating high-fiber foods to avoid obstruction of the
ileum.
c. Irrigate the ileostomy daily to avoid having to wear a drainage
appliance.
d. Change the pouch every day to prevent leakage of contents onto
the skin. Answer: B
